Snowboarder Dies At Sugar Bowl Ski Resort
DONNER SUMMIT (CBS13) - A snowboarder was killed Monday on a run at Sugar Bowl Ski Resort.
Justin McCullum, 20, of Roseville, was an employee of the resort and was riding with friends on the Strawberry Fields run at around 2:30 p.m. when he didn't make it to the bottom. His friends apparently went back up and found him upside down in a tree well and called 911, according to Sgt. Paul Walker of the Placer County Sheriff's Dept.
Ski patrol performed first aid on McCullum then brought him down the hill where he was pronounced dead.
The identity of the man has not been released pending notification of family.
Strawberry Fields is described as an advanced run.
